Event Summary
A 3.0 magnitude earthquake struck on WESTERN TEXAS, at Tue, 18 Nov 2025 00:18:15 GMT. Depth: 5km. Reviewed by NEIC seismologists, this minor quake occurred at a magnitude type of ml.
